Senior professional sales representative vs specialty representative

The differences between senior professional sales representatives and specialty representatives can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 1-2 years to become both a senior professional sales representative and a specialty representative. Additionally, a senior professional sales representative has an average salary of $112,236, which is higher than the $49,201 average annual salary of a specialty representative.

The top three skills for a senior professional sales representative include pharmaceutical products, neurology and disease state. The most important skills for a specialty representative are patients, oncology, and dermatology.
